100 750 519 510 507 501 493 488 473 466 457 457 453 451 450 447 443 443 441 440 438 434 430 428 424 421 418 416 406 403 401 400 398 397 394 387 385 375 372 371 371 370 367 367 364 359 356 356 337 337 336 331 328 326 325 323 314 312 311 309 303 301 298 298 295 291 285 283 282 281 281 276 275 274 261 260 257 247 245 244 239 237 237 230 222 220 219 205 201 199 198 194 193 186 185 185 176 175 164 161 160 158